Ethereum ETF Inflows Surge as Institutional Demand Rises

Institutional investors are flocking to Ethereum-backed exchange-traded funds (ETFs), signaling a growing belief in the cryptocurrency’s future. Recent data reveals unprecedented inflows into these products, led by BlackRock’s iShares Ethereum Trust (ETHA). This surge highlights Ethereum’s increasing dominance over Bitcoin in institutional portfolios.
